In “Naming Names,” the late author/journalist Victor Navasky describes the time playwright Arthur Miller reportedly sent Kazan a copy of his play, “A View from the Bridge,” which deals with informing. Kazan wrote back his thanks, saying he would be honored to direct it. Miller shot back: “You don’t understand. I didn’t send it to you because I wanted you to direct it. I sent it to you because I wanted you to know what I think of stool pigeons.
At 5,242 square feet, the home features five fireplaces and five private outdoor spaces totaling 1,700 square feet, including a garden, two covered terraces and a roof deck. There’s also a coveted “curb cut” for private parking. The exterior features a stucco facade and three windows across. The 17-foot-wide townhouse is outside the Historic District and comes with a maximum buildable of 18,220 square feet. It currently includes a full-height cellar with a laundry room, storage and mechanical systems.
